Application Materials

To be considered for District Teacher of the Year, you will need to submit the following by Noon on Monday, February 10, 2025:

  • Essay One (Limit: Two double-spaced pages) Describe a content lesson or unit that defines you as a teacher. How did you engage students of all backgrounds and abilities in the learning? How did that learning influence your students? How are your beliefs about teaching demonstrated in this lesson or unit?

  • Essay Two (Limit: Two double-spaced pages) How do you ensure that education transcends the classroom? Describe specific ways in which you connect your students with the community. Please include evidence of student impact.

  • Letter of Recommendation Letter written by a person of your choice (see restrictions on who is eligible to write a letter) sharing why you are an outstanding teacher. Space limit: 8.5 x 11, single-sided, may be single-spaced, double-spaced or handwritten. 

    Restrictions on whom is eligible to write the letter:
    The letter may be written by anyone except for students to whom you currently assign a grade, parents of students to whom you currently assign a grade, district-level administrators, and School Board members.  

  • Your photo: Please submit a high-resolution jpeg image as part of your online application. Yearbook photos/head and shoulder professional portraits are ideal. No selfies. The selection committee does not see photos. Photos are used for publicity purposes after Finalists have been named.

Responses should be typed and double-spaced with at least one-inch margins. The font size must be 12 points or larger. The application must be submitted via the online application link that was sent to you via email to the Public Communications Office by Noon on Monday, February 10, 2025

All documents must be submitted in the online application link that was sent to you via email.
